Signature Elements of an Art Deco Bathroom
At the heart of an Art Deco bathroom renovation are several key elements. First, integrating luxurious textures like mahogany or chrome can immediately elevate the space. Gold accents are essential for that touch of Gatsby-esque glamour. As highlighted in various sources, consider vintage mirrors or antique light fixtures as these pieces capture the essence of Art Deco elegance.
Color Palette: A Dance of Contrasts
The colors you choose can dramatically influence the atmosphere of your bathroom. Inspired by both WanderLife Studios and Stone Tile Depot, a palette combining blacks, whites, and gold with rich jewel tones like emerald or sapphire creates a striking balance. Such combinations provide a bold backdrop while allowing lighter elements, like white fixtures or patterned tiles, to shine through.
Tile Trends That Define Art Deco
Subway tiles are a staple in Art Deco bathrooms, often used to evoke an urban chic vibe. This classic feature pairs well with intricate tile patterns, as elaborated in the reference articles. For instance, the integration of hexagon or chevron tiles can enhance the visual interest while adhering to the signature Art Deco style. Whether you opt for a vibrant backsplash or a textured floor, these choices will contribute significantly to your bathroom’s overall design.
Adding Personality: Décor and Art
One of the most exciting aspects of an Art Deco renovation is the opportunity to make it uniquely yours. Incorporate line art pieces or sculptures that reflect the geometric lines synonymous with this design era. As mentioned in the WanderLife Studios guide, including plants can soften the sharp angles while adding life to the room, creating a blend of nature and elegance.
Planning Your Art Deco Bathroom Makeover
To embark on this captivating journey, begin by selecting a focal piece—a clawfoot bathtub, for instance, can serve as a magnificent centerpiece. Build around it with complementary colors and materials. Remember, Art Deco is about boldness; don't shy away from integrating eye-catching elements that speak to your personal style.
